WHAT IS AN OPEN SOURCE ENGINEER JOB?

An open source engineer job refers to a specialized position in the field of software development that focuses on utilizing and contributing to open source technologies. Open source refers to software that is freely available and can be modified and distributed by anyone. Open source engineers play a crucial role in developing, maintaining, and improving open source projects. They work closely with a community of developers and contribute their expertise to enhance the functionality and usability of open source software.

WHAT USUALLY DO IN THIS POSITION?

In an open source engineer job, professionals typically have a range of responsibilities. They collaborate with other developers in the open source community to identify bugs and issues in existing software and propose solutions. They also contribute their own code and enhancements to open source projects, ensuring that they align with the project's goals and guidelines. Open source engineers often conduct code reviews, provide technical support to users, and participate in discussions and forums related to open source software.

TOP 5 SKILLS FOR THE POSITION

To excel in an open source engineer position, there are several key skills that are highly valuable: 1. Proficiency in Programming Languages: Open source engineers should have a strong command over programming languages such as Python, Java, C++, or Ruby. This enables them to understand and contribute effectively to open source projects written in different languages. 2. Knowledge of Version Control Systems: Familiarity with version control systems like Git or SVN is crucial for open source engineers. These tools help in managing code changes, collaboration, and tracking the history of modifications made to open source projects. 3. Problem-Solving and Debugging Skills: Open source engineers need to be adept at identifying and resolving issues in software. Strong problem-solving and debugging skills enable them to troubleshoot problems, fix bugs, and improve the overall quality of open source projects. 4. Understanding of Open Source Principles: Open source engineers should have a deep understanding of the principles and ethos of the open source community. This includes being familiar with licenses, contributing guidelines, and the collaborative nature of open source development. 5. Communication and Collaboration: Effective communication and collaboration skills are essential for open source engineers. They need to interact with other developers, discuss ideas, provide feedback, and work together to achieve common goals in the open source community.

HOW TO BECOME THIS TYPE OF SPECIALIST?

To become an open source engineer, individuals can follow these steps: 1. Gain a Strong Foundation in Computer Science: Start by obtaining a degree in computer science or a related field. This provides a solid foundation in programming, algorithms, and software development principles. 2. Develop Programming Skills: Focus on learning popular programming languages like Python, Java, or C++. Practice coding regularly and work on personal projects to build a strong portfolio. 3. Contribute to Open Source Projects: Start by exploring existing open source projects and finding ones that align with your interests. Contribute code, report bugs, and participate in discussions to establish your presence in the open source community. 4. Build a Network: Attend meetups, conferences, and online forums related to open source software. Network with other developers, learn from their experiences, and seek mentorship opportunities. 5. Showcase Your Work: Create a portfolio that highlights your contributions to open source projects. This could include links to your GitHub profile, documentation you have written, or any significant enhancements you have made to open source software.

AVERAGE SALARY

The average salary for open source engineers can vary depending on factors such as experience, location, and the specific industry they work in. According to data from various sources, the average salary for open source engineers ranges from $80,000 to $120,000 per year. However, it's important to note that salaries can be higher for experienced professionals or those working in industries with high demand for open source expertise.

ROLES AND TYPES

Open source engineering encompasses various roles and types of positions. Some common roles in this field include: 1. Open Source Developer: These professionals primarily focus on coding and contributing to open source projects. They write code, fix bugs, and implement new features based on the project's requirements. 2. Open Source Project Manager: Project managers in the open source domain oversee the development and coordination of open source projects. They ensure that projects are delivered on time, manage resources, and facilitate collaboration among developers. 3. Open Source Evangelist: An open source evangelist promotes the use and benefits of open source software within organizations. They educate and advocate for the adoption of open source technologies, both internally and externally. 4. Open Source Community Manager: Community managers play a vital role in fostering collaboration and engagement within the open source community. They facilitate communication, resolve conflicts, and encourage participation from developers around the world.

WHAT ARE THE TYPICAL TOOLS?

Open source engineers use a variety of tools to enhance their productivity and contribute effectively to open source projects. Some typical tools used in this field include: 1. Git: Git is a version control system widely used in open source development. It allows developers to track changes, collaborate with others, and manage code repositories efficiently. 2. GitHub: GitHub is a web-based platform that provides hosting for Git repositories. It facilitates collaboration, code review, and issue tracking, making it an essential tool for open source engineers. 3. Bugzilla: Bugzilla is a bug tracking system that helps open source engineers manage and track reported issues and bugs in software projects. It enables efficient communication and resolution of software defects. 4. Jenkins: Jenkins is an open source automation server that facilitates continuous integration and continuous delivery (CI/CD) in software development. Open source engineers use Jenkins to automate build, test, and deployment processes. 5. Docker: Docker is a popular containerization platform that allows open source engineers to package applications and their dependencies into lightweight, portable containers. It simplifies the deployment and management of software across different environments.
